Histamine is a chemical mediator. These are released by mammalian cells and effect their cells in their immediate vicinity. Histamines are released from white blood cells in the airways, they are released in response to injury or an allergen. They cause small arteries and arterioles to dilate and the permeability of capillaries to increase. They produce an inflammatory response where swelling, itching and redness occurs.
Histamines are what causes allergic reactions in people. They can cause hives, itchy skin, runny or stuffy nose and watery eyes.

Mast cells and basophils produce the histamine, which antihistamines block. The cytoplasm of a mast cell is filled with granules containing histamine and heparin. Histamine, released after injury or infection, stimulates local inflamation. People often take antihistamines to reduce cold symptoms. Basophils, blood cells that enter damaged tissues and enhance the inflammation process, also contain granules of histamine and haparin.
Basophils are a type of white blood cell. They function in the immune system in allergic reactions. They also contain heparin to prevent the blood from clotting too quickly, and histamine which dilates blood vessels.
